Output 23e2554c951dda11595512b3d40d663678c9ec260bc2155f305453b29743eaba: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fad4795aa451120109593db8e70456a677be571 OP_EQUAL
address
3637GEqVSdL3KW66hAvWQ3sqfqfGJfmxcS
transaction
23e2554c951dda11595512b3d40d663678c9ec260bc2155f305453b29743eaba
confirmations
490947
spent
true